Transaction 860f89233dfb7076767dcff46ae4e2c6393dd866ec6563c44c8cd25bf249f03f

1 Input
2 Outputs
  • 860f89233dfb7076767dcff46ae4e2c6393dd866ec6563c44c8cd25bf249f03f:0
  • value  514614
    address  3HtDogTTAk3P49eQvz7DgfcghuUmesxtVj
  • 860f89233dfb7076767dcff46ae4e2c6393dd866ec6563c44c8cd25bf249f03f:1
  • value  2120
    address  bc1q8ewjhd6yyxl5tk2592psj0rqhcvp96f7cdpzwe